The project, whose initial value is approximately $300,000, includes business consultancy and Professional Services (job) professional services - A department of a supplier providing consultancy and programming manpower for the supplier's products. , and is expected to go live in June June: see month. 2002. The project will be developed using the Magic eDeveloper application development environment. United Utilities operates and maintains electricity and water distribution networks, which delivers electricity to 2.2 million customer premises and water to 2.9 million premises in North West England

Magic Software will integrate United Utilities Networks' existing database infrastructure and legacy systems using Magic eDeveloper to create this new solution. The solution will enable business customers to access their online quotation system for major orders, such as new housing estates and business parks. It will streamline their current quotation system and enable them to provide a fast and efficient service to their customers. Magic Software first provided United Utilities Networks with a consultancy "Business Needs" workshop to establish a specific online strategy. Once the business objectives and requirements had been decided, Magic designed a detailed development plan to integrate the relevant systems. United Utilities provides multi-utility connection services across the UK servicing a total of 11 million customers; 1 in 5 of the UK population. As part of its service, it treats and distributes around 2,000 million litres of water a day to, and removes and treats wastewater from, nearly 3 million homes and businesses.
